Alright peeps! I think I have my template 90% done. I'm sharing it with you now (and editing the first post). Any help to further upgrade the template (ESRB back labels, blu-ray logos, PAL design, etc.) would be appreciated.
Edit: February 12, 2009
Alright v1.0.1 has been completed. Here's what I have done:
- BLUS & Numbers are on their own layer.
- Attempted to add a layer for the "PSN Network" logo when the game isn't exclusive to the PS3.
- Adobe Photoshop file created (.PSD)
Things that still need to be worked on for now:
- Adding additional ESRB logos & other territory logos
- Need to find a better quality PSN logo to replace the current "PSN Network" logos at the top of the front and back.

I could say the same thing for the next Nintendo Handheld, yet people are converting GBA to DS cases. What if the next Nintendo handheld comes in a non-DS case?
Besides, it's more so for fun. It's also easier to get a hold of a blank DVD case instead of a blank Blu-ray PS3 case. Blu-ray cases aren't universal across the ponds. For example, PAL movie cases are thicker (spine-wise) than the american counterpart.
Besides, not like there's a slew of PS3 games coming out these days. I'm only looking to do my three games: LittleBigPlanet, Heavenly Sword, and Metal Gear Solid 4. Plus there's that demand for the MGS Essentials vol 2 to be made into DVD case as well. It's just another option for people really.
